### Soft Deletes in `orders`

Quick heads-up before you touch the Marlinware orders table: we never hard-delete rows. Setting `deleted_at` is the whole ceremony — every query path must filter on it, and yes, people forget constantly. The nightly Tidewrack job archives anything soft-deleted for 90+ days, so don't assume old rows stick around. If you add a new read path, add the filter and a test. Questions about edge cases or the archive job should go to the data platform crew.

escalation mailbox, bafog-fafog: ulador@paliqlabs.internal

# Canary gating rules — Driftway deploy pipeline
# Plugin authors: gates run in order; first failure aborts promotion.
# Gate 1: error rate delta < 0.5% over 10 min.
# Gate 2: p95 latency within 15% of baseline.
# Gate 3: no new crash signatures.
# Custom gates must return within 30s or they count as failed.
# Gate results are written to the verdict store; do not write there directly.
# The pipeline reads the verdict store via the connection string below.

replica DSN, kagug-tafof: clickhouse://norir_svc:elHq8Ay@db-9735.halixdyn.internal:5432/rusax

Changelog — Ferndale Query Engine 7.1

Renamed PLANNER_COST_MODEL to FQE_PLANNER_PROFILE. Plugin authors: the old key silently no-ops in 7.1, which reintroduces the seq-scan regression from 6.8 on wide partitioned tables. Set FQE_PLANNER_PROFILE=calibrated in your plugin's engine.env to restore 7.0 plan selection. Plugins that report plan telemetry must also supply the telemetry ingest secret, placed on the line directly after the profile setting.

env line for fafof-fahag: LEDGER_TOKEN5=f8790